A:AnswerOur TCL Roku TVs do not currently support Bluetooth. However, you can download the free Roku app on your smart phone or tablet to use voice search, voice control, and experience private listening. To enjoy private listening you simply click private listening in the app, and attach headphones to your smart phone or tablet. Or you can use the 3.5 mm headphone jack in the back of the TV to connect standard headphones. Hope this helps! Thank you, TCL Customer Support
A:AnswerThis TCL Roku TV uses a combination of advanced signal processing and back light scanning to enhance the native refresh rate and present an effective refresh rate of 120Hz CMI. The result is a smooth, blur free image, perfect for fast moving sports or video games. Hope this helps! Thank you, TCL Customer Support

A:AnswerThe description lists it as supporting 120HZ but the TV doesn't actually support it. It is capped out at 60HZ compatibility. See the attached pics. Hope that helps .
A:AnswerWhile this TCL Roku TV features an effective refresh rate of 120Hz CMI, it does not support 120Hz input from external connected devices. Hope this helps! Thank you, TCL Customer Support
